Calcium Hydride Cation Dimer Catalyzed Hydrogenation of Unactivated 1‐Alkenes and H(2) Isotope Exchange: Competitive Ca−H−Ca Bridges and Terminal Ca−H Bonds
Recently, it was shown that the double Ca−H−Ca bridged calcium hydride cation dimer complex [LCaH(2)CaL](2+) (macrocyclic ligand L=NNNN‐tetradentate Me(4)TACD) exhibited remarkable activity in catalyzing the hydrogenation of unactivated 1‐alkenes as well as the H(2) isotope exchange under mild condi...
